Right to Know: media freedom and Australian democracy are on the line

By Rex Patrick
Updated July 2 2021 - 3:02am, first published November 4 2019 - 4:30am

Last week the front pages of Australia's major newspapers, including Australian Community Media mastheads The Canberra Times, Newcastle Herald, Illawarra Mercury and many others, were blacked out in a protest against the culture of government secrecy that's stifling public debate and the public interest.
